NSSDCA/COSPAR ID: 1970-091A
Cosmos 375, launched one week after Cosmos 374, repeated most of the same maneuvers of its redecessor. It maneuvered from its initial orbit into a more extreme eccentric orbit, made a flyby of Cosmos 373, and was exploded into many pieces. The Tass announcement said "... the scientific research envisaged by the program has been completed."
Launch Date: 1970-10-30
Launch Vehicle: Tsiklon
Launch Site: Tyuratam (Baikonur Cosmodrome), U.S.S.R
Mass: 3320 kg
